RE: door arm rest peeling
Yep it is a common problem. I tried to paint mine when it happened, but it never really looked good. Best bet is to go buy replacements from Audi. Removal is a real pain in the butt. You'll see inside the door handle is a screw. You have to remove that and then remove the black plastic insert. From there you can remove a few more screws from behind. You'll also need to remove the door panel to gain access to the back side.

RE: door arm rest peeling
If you decide to paint them be sure to remove all the old "paint" first and clean them with a wax and grease remover. The problem may have been caused becasue the parts were not cleaned properly before. Also, before painting them with your desired color, coat them with a plastic primer. This will ensure the best adheasion and they will not peel again.
